What is the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use?
The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use is a legal document designed for cardholders to report unauthorized transactions. Its primary purpose is to assist individuals in formally communicating instances of fraud to their financial institutions, including credit unions. This affidavit can cover various unauthorized activities, such as credit card transactions, debit card purchases, and ATM withdrawals.
By utilizing a fraudulent card affidavit, individuals can help ensure that their financial institutions take proactive measures against these unauthorized activities. The document plays a critical role in maintaining financial security and accountability for both cardholders and banks.
Purpose and Benefits of the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use
Filing the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use is essential for cardholders who are facing fraudulent activity. By submitting this document, individuals can protect themselves from potential liability for transactions they did not authorize.
Some benefits of filing this affidavit include:
-
Protection from being held responsible for unauthorized charges.
-
Facilitation of investigations into reported transactions.
-
Clarity and documentation of the fraudulent activities for future reference.
Who Needs the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use?
The affidavit is specifically aimed at cardholders who have experienced fraud involving their credit or debit cards. It is crucial for these individuals to acknowledge fraudulent activities as soon as possible to mitigate potential loss.
In the completion of the affidavit, two key roles are involved:
-
The cardholder, who reports the unauthorized transactions.
-
The Notary Public, who ensures the affidavit is legally binding through notarization.

What Happens After You Submit the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use?
Following the submission of your affidavit, the financial institution typically initiates a review process that may involve investigating the reported unauthorized transactions. You can expect to receive communication from your credit union regarding their findings and any necessary follow-up actions.
To keep track of your affidavit, it is advisable to check its status regularly, especially if you submitted it online or in person.

Who is eligible to use the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use?
Any cardholder who has experienced unauthorized transactions on their credit card, debit card, or ATM card can use this affidavit to report fraud to their credit union.
What information do I need to complete this form?
You will need details about the unauthorized transactions, such as dates, amounts, and merchant names, along with your personal information for accurate processing.
How do I submit the completed affidavit?
Once completed, you can submit the affidavit to your credit union by mail, in person, or through their online submission platform, depending on the credit union's procedures.
Is notarization required for the affidavit?
Yes, the Affidavit of Fraudulent Credit Card Use requires notarization to verify the authenticity of the signature, making it legally binding.
What are some common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Avoid incomplete information, spelling errors, and overlooking the notarization requirement. Thoroughly review the affidavit before submission to prevent processing delays.
How long does it take for the affidavit to be processed?
Processing times vary by credit union, but you can typically expect a response within a few business days after submission.
Are there any fees associated with filing this affidavit?
Filing the affidavit itself usually does not entail fees, but check with your credit union for any specific policies or potential fees related to processing fraud claims.
